We are happy to announce that we will be holding our next conference from 9-11 October 2012 in Köln, Germany. Please put this date in your diary now! The theme will be Turning Tides . We believe that the tide of materialism and secularism which swept over Europe in the 20th century may be changing, as people become more open to spirituality in general and missional, relevant Christianity in particular. We will be examining the evidence for this change, and considering the practicalities involved in running with it. We are confident that the conference will be relevant to people involved in both the practical work of church planting and the theoretical work about church planting. We hope the discussions will provide a stimulus to planting more churches more effectively throughout the continent. Speakers include: Rt Rev Graham Cray (UK), Gerard Kelly (FR), Daniel Liechti (FR), Prof Stefan Paas (NL), Rt Rev Tony Palmer (IT) and others. The venue will be the Köln-Deutz youth hostel situated conveniently on the east bank of the Rhine river opposite the famous cathedral and the railway station. With comfortable modern rooms, quality conference facilities and convenient catering arrangements, this promises to be an excellent meeting place. For more information visit their website. The youth hostel is only 15 minutes by train from Cologne-Bonn International Airport, and is adjacent to a significant railway station. It also has easy access from the motorway.
